Long process around 3 months.
I applied online, a recruiter reached out soon after. The recruiters were friendly but they did'nt clearly explain the interview process. Attended remote interview with a bunch of amazonians every one was very focused on the leadership principal.
Questions d'entretien [1]
Question 1
1) A machine learning take home assignment . It was a prediction problem using simplest method.
2) Phone Interview with ML Scientist - Basic questions in ML
3) Onsite - 5 rounds of interview
Every round focuses on Behavioural questions. Amazon breathes these principals.
1) Presentation - about a project you recently worked on (be prepared to get grilled)
2) Algo and DS - Not what you typically expect. It was more of a design problem
3) ML Application - About a Amazon product design using ML
4) ML breadth - Questions to test on your ML expertise
5) ML coding - Focus is more on functional programming and less on ML.
Applied for Amazon AGI. After first round, it will go into full round of multiple interviews. Lots of modern LLM training technic questions. There are still some behavioral questions, but less than general Amazon roles.
Interviewed with 1 phone screen, 1 coding, 2 ml design and 2 lp rounds. Most questions were non-leetcode questions more related to day to day ml implementations. The questions were very practical.
